We’ll look to you for:

  • Always ensure Railway Safety and EHS standards are respected,

  • Understand and support the implementation of Alstom production standards related to Industrial Roadmap,

  • Lead the industrialization of technical documentation, respecting the Standard Manufacturing Process & Standard Manufacturing Line guidelines, footprint,

  • Elaborate the required industrial deliverables: Macro-process, Work Instructions, implantation of the workstations, Bill of Material, Task Sequence and/or Standard Operations Sheet, Work Instructions, Method times, definitive Layouts,

  • Elaborate the specification of requirements for the Industrial means and tools, in particular relating to Infrastructure, Tools and Capex,

  • Design the tool, or subcontract the tooling design activities,

  • Set up Bill of Material, Routings or Task list in the ERP, and ensure production work order generation,

  • Support Sourcing during supplier selection,

  • Analyze the need for tooling and propose the adequate solutions,

  • Validate the Operations tooling during First Article Inspection, including operating procedures, inspection and maintenance procedure, calibration requirement
